South West commons conference

25 September 2012

The biennial conference of the South West Uplands Federation is being held at Exeter Racecourse on Friday 19 October 2012, hosted by the Dartmoor Preservation Association. The conference will focus on the grazed commons of Bodmin, Exmoor and Dartmoor, the day-to-day practicalities of commons management and the implications of CAP reform and other policy changes. It will explore ways in which the interests of commoners and agriculture can complement the immense public benefit of commons.

Speakers include commoners and common owners, policy makers and local and national figures, including our general secretary, Kate Ashbrook.
